And since I went through the trouble to type out the sharing of a network drive, here it is anyway
On the computer that has a working CD drive:
1. Insert CD into drive.
2. Go to My Computer and locate drive with CD.
3. Right click on drive and click on "Sharing and Security".
4. Click on "If you understand the risk but still want to share the root of the drive, click here." It will be underlined and in a blue color.
5. Click on the box next to "Share this folder on the network."
6. Click the Apply button.
7. Click the Ok button.
On your laptop:
1. Connect to the same network the previous computer is on.
2. Make sure both of the computers have the same Workgroup name. This can be found by right clicking on My Computer and selecting Properties. Then go to the 2nd tab titled Computer Name. You'll see Workgroup listed in there. If they are different, you need to change one by clicking on the "Change..." button and typing in the matching name under the Workgroup dialog box. Then click the Ok button and restart the computer to apply the changes.
3. Click on My Network Places and locate the shared drive.
4. Open it up and locate the install file and click on it.
